The year 2021 not only marks the 30th anniversary of China-ASEAN dialogue and relations, but also witnesses the steady progress of the Regional Comprehensive Economic Partnership (RCEP). Once implemented, the RCEP is expected to significantly eliminate tariffs between its signatory nations, and further promote regional value chains, trade, and intellectual property. The RCEP will help form a more secure and diversified supply chain, while facilitating closer regional economic and social connections.


On June 17th, China Development Institute and KSI Strategic Institute for Asia Pacific jointly held a webinar, bring together public representatives, academics, and professionals in the hope of providing insights into the next steps for regional economic cooperation and the RCEP’s complementary role to the Belt and Road Initiative (BRI).
